Retaining customers is vital for the success of any auto repair shop. Repeat clients not only provide steady revenue but also serve as ambassadors who can bring in new customers through word-of-mouth. Implementing effective retention strategies can help your shop stand out in a competitive market.
Understanding Customer Retention
Customer retention refers to the ability of a business to keep its clients coming back over time. For auto repair shops, this means building trust, providing quality service, and maintaining good relationships with customers.
Key Strategies for Customer Retention
1. Offer Exceptional Service
Providing high-quality repairs and maintenance builds trust. Ensure your staff is well-trained, courteous, and attentive to customer needs. Going the extra mile can turn a one-time customer into a loyal client.
2. Implement Loyalty Programs
Loyalty programs reward repeat customers with discounts, free services, or other perks. These incentives encourage clients to return and can increase overall customer satisfaction.
3. Maintain Regular Communication
Use email newsletters, texts, or phone calls to keep customers informed about special offers, service reminders, or seasonal tips. Personalized communication makes clients feel valued.
4. Follow Up After Service
Contact customers after their service to ensure satisfaction. Address any concerns promptly, demonstrating that you care about their experience and feedback.
Building Long-Term Relationships
Establishing trust and providing consistent, reliable service are the foundations of customer loyalty. Personal touches, such as remembering a customer’s preferences or vehicle history, can enhance the relationship.
